You seriously need to try it!} So, being a popcorn lover, I wanted to make a sweet treat variation of popcorn so I made Cookies & Cream Popcorn!
- 2 bags microwaveable kettle corn popcorn
- 24 Oreo cookies, finely crushed {I did half regular and half mint flavored}
- 1 {12 oz) bag white chocolate chips
- Pop 2 bags of popcorn according to instruction. Place in a large bowl.
- Combine the cookies and popcorn. Mix thoroughly.
- Melt chocolate chips in the microwave in 30 second increments, mixing in between until smooth.
- Pour half of the melted chocolate chips over the popcorn/cookie mixture and use spatula to evenly coat.
- Pour the other half of the melted chocolate chips over and stir to coat again.
- Spread popcorn out on parchment paper and allow chocolate to set for about 30 minutes. Store in an airtight container.

I love that you can switch this recipe up by using any “flavor” of Oreo cookies to make this! Since I used half mint oreos, it has a subtle minty flavor! Delicious! And perfect for St. Patty’s Day! But you could use any flavor out there to give it a little twist! Try it with the chocolate peanut butter Oreos, or the berry Oreos, or even the coconut Oreos for a different flavor each time! YUM!
